A couple of things by the way of truck racing evolutions.

CORR runs 2 and 4wd drive and what is generally regarded as the top class is the 4s.

In SCORE the top classes are generaly going to 4wd trucks since it offers better tracton and handling at speed. Before they avoided 4wd to cut back costs and they were primarily going with i-beam suspension in the front and cost are out of controll anyways.

But for some reason now they are going with an a-arm suspension that is more compatible with 4wd.

On the flip side if that there is the big controversy in the extreme crawling camp now that some guys are selling of their straight axle buggies and fabbing new ones using a-arm and IFS technology.
